Dr. Hansuld graduated with a B.A. from the University of Northern Iowa, a Masters in Music from North Texas State University, and a PhD. in Music from the University of Miami, Florida.  His Masters Thesis was on teaching music history and theory through rehearsal, while his Doctoral Dissertation concentrated on instrumental techniques.  He studied with John Paynter of Northwestern University, Chicago, IL, Frederick Fennell of the Eastman School of Music, Rochester, NY, Harry Glantz, Principal Trumpet under Toscanini with the NBC Orchestra, and composer Clifton Williams and Alfred Reed.  Dr. Hansuld was band and orchestra director for the Dalla, TX public schools and Assistant Conductor and Brass Coach for the all-city Dal-HiOrchestra.  He was a graduate instructor at the University of Miami teaching music history and appreciation, Music Professor at Marietta College, OH, Hiram College, OH, and Iowa Western Community College, where he conducted the Iowa Western Band, and the Omaha PopsOrchestra. He has been Assistant Conductor of the Pinellas Park Civic Orchestra since 2008.
